Power & Performance

2025 Toyota Tacoma:
The latest Tacoma brings a turbocharged 2.4L 4-cylinder engine, delivering up to 278 horsepower and 317 lb-ft of torque. What truly sets the Tacoma apart for 2025 is the introduction of the i-FORCE MAX hybrid powertrain, which outputs 326 horsepower and 465 lb-ft of torque—figures that make the Tacoma one of the most powerful midsize pickups in its class. This powertrain is standard on high-performance trims like the TRD Pro and Trailhunter, ensuring adventurers get the most muscle when they hit the trail.

2025 Toyota Tundra:
For those who need more strength for heavier jobs, the Tundra comes standard with an i-FORCE twin-turbo V6 engine, offering 389 horsepower and 479 lb-ft of torque. The i-FORCE MAX hybrid version raises the bar even higher with 437 horsepower and 583 lb-ft of torque, delivering best-in-class power for serious towing and hauling.

This is an important consideration for drivers planning to tow boats, trailers, or heavy construction equipment around Tampa and the Gulf Coast.

Winner for Power: Toyota Tundra

Towing Capacity & Payload

When it comes to moving heavy loads, these trucks deliver—but in very different ways.

Tacoma Towing & Payload:

  • Max Towing: 6,500 lbs
  • Max Payload: 1,709 lbs

Tundra Towing & Payload:

  • Max Towing: 12,000 lbs
  • Max Payload: 1,940 lbs

The Tundra clearly leads in both towing and payload categories. If you're frequently hauling a large trailer or heavy gear for work or recreation, the Tundra’s full-size strength gives it the edge.

Winner for Towing: Toyota Tundra

Off-Road Capability

2025 Tacoma Off-Road Strengths:
The Tacoma’s reputation as an off-road icon remains intact for 2025. Equipped with Multi-Terrain Select, Crawl Control, Electronically Locking Rear Differential, and Bilstein or FOX off-road shocks (depending on trim), the Tacoma’s TRD Off-Road, TRD Pro, and Trailhunter trims are made to tackle Florida’s trails, beaches, and beyond. The new IsoDynamic seats in the TRD Pro model offer extra stability and comfort for extreme terrain.

2025 Tundra Off-Road Strengths:
The Tundra’s TRD Off-Road and TRD Pro trims provide similar off-road features, including Multi-Terrain Select, Downhill Assist Control, and skid plates. The TRD Pro trim adds FOX® internal bypass shocks and Crawl Control, giving it real capability for full-size truck off-roading. However, its larger size makes it slightly less agile on tight trails compared to the Tacoma.

Winner for Off-Roading: Toyota Tacoma

Interior & Technology

Tacoma Interior:
The redesigned 2025 Tacoma offers a refined cabin with modern amenities like an 8-inch touchscreen (standard) or available 14-inch display, wireless Apple CarPlay® and Android Auto™, and an all-new Toyota Audio Multimedia System. Adventure-ready trims like the Trailhunter include all-weather floor mats, rugged upholstery, and built-in utility functions.

Tundra Interior:
Inside the Tundra, you’ll find a more upscale and spacious cabin. Higher trims like the Platinum and Capstone offer leather-trimmed seating, heated and ventilated seats, panoramic sunroof, and 14-inch infotainment screens. The available 12.3-inch digital instrument cluster, Head-Up Display, and Toyota Safety Sense 3.0 elevate the Tundra to near-luxury levels of refinement.

If you prioritize a tech-rich driving experience and extra space for passengers, the Tundra stands out.

Winner for Comfort & Tech: Toyota Tundra

Trim Levels & Customization

2025 Tacoma Trims: SR, SR5, TRD PreRunner, TRD Sport, TRD Off-Road, Limited, TRD Pro, Trailhunter

2025 Tundra Trims: SR, SR5, Limited, Platinum, 1794 Edition, TRD Pro, Capstone

Both lineups offer variety, but the Tundra’s trims move from practical utility to full luxury, while the Tacoma focuses more on adventure and utility. For overlanding and daily driving versatility, Tacoma offers more lifestyle-focused builds.

Winner for Custom Builds: Toyota Tacoma

Fuel Economy

Tacoma (i-FORCE MAX Hybrid): Estimated up to 26 MPG combined
Tundra (i-FORCE MAX Hybrid): Estimated up to 20–22 MPG combined

Thanks to its smaller size and hybrid availability, the Tacoma wins here—especially for daily commuters and road trippers concerned with gas prices.

Winner for Fuel Efficiency: Toyota Tacoma

Price Comparison

2025 Toyota Tacoma Starting MSRP: Around $31,500
2025 Toyota Tundra Starting MSRP: Around $39,965

Though both trucks offer excellent value for their segment, the Tacoma remains more affordable for those looking to enter the pickup market without sacrificing performance or tech. If you don’t need full-size towing capacity, the Tacoma offers a balanced package at a lower cost.

Winner for Budget-Friendly Buyers: Toyota Tacoma
